The Sycamore is tucked away on 20+ beautifully wooded acres along the Little River in southeastern Oklahoma. Bring a hammock and soak in the fresh air, wildlife, and starry skies. Don't forget your binoculars for bird watching, or a rare Bald Eagle sighting. By booking the entire campground, you may enjoy a stay in one of our spacious, air conditioned bell tents which can sleep up to 6 people each, or self-camp in an RV spot or tent. An old hunting cabin has been converted to a communal space containing a shared restroom with a shower, and kitchen. Outdoor enthusiasts can take advantage of fishing in the river or nearby lake, hiking, and cycling. Enjoy your private gathering or event for up to 30 people!

Good place to getaway and relax.
Wife & I are new to using RV sites, so we're still learning about our trailer's abilities, functionality, and amenities. Keeping that in mind we enjoyed our stay. This campground has a great deal of potential and after visiting with one of the owners I think they have a great vision of what they want their facility to become. Overall the communication with Em was easy and she was quick to respond and Nels was there to help us set up and do some mowing. We weren't able to use Site #1 due to some electrical issues which wasn't a major problem since we were the only people there for the weekend we moved to a different site. Pros: quiet, isolated, great for getting back to nature and relaxing under the stars. Cons: power boxes need to be updated & marked for 30 or 50 use. Or better yet have all three sites setup for permanent use by both 30 & 50. Personally I would love to return and stay again, when the weather cools down. The 105°+ heat kept us from really enjoying everything there was available.

I am going to give my honest review and no disrespect is intended toward the host. The camp sites are not private but luckily we were the only ones there that weekend. The tent was roomy but the the air mattress would not stay fully inflated and slid around on the metal frame. The cabin was in bad shape and we only used the restroom when absolutely necessary (the shower was absolutely out of the question). The stove looked like it was about to fall apart and the counter had dead bugs and spiders all over it. We did catch a couple of fish but access to the river was a bit difficult for our 7 year old. While I understand the reasoning, the fire pit was too far away from the tent and we had to bring our own firewood. You could forage in the woods for firewood but if you wandered off the area that had been mowed you ended up with little stickers all over you. There were no trash cans and you had to take all your trash with you which was inconvenient since we had a 2 hour drive home with the trash in our car. Unfortunately I would not recommend this campsite.
